2026/2/10 7:45:31
网站建设
项目流程
河北省建设招标网站,最佳搜索引擎磁力王,网站无收录的原因,html网站开发心得体会万物识别模型对比#xff1a;如何用云端GPU快速测试多个中文模型
作为一名AI产品经理#xff0c;我经常需要评估不同识别模型在业务场景中的表现。手动部署每个模型不仅耗时耗力#xff0c;还需要处理复杂的依赖关系和显存分配问题。本文将分享如何利用云端GPU环境快速测试多…万物识别模型对比如何用云端GPU快速测试多个中文模型作为一名AI产品经理我经常需要评估不同识别模型在业务场景中的表现。手动部署每个模型不仅耗时耗力还需要处理复杂的依赖关系和显存分配问题。本文将分享如何利用云端GPU环境快速测试多个中文万物识别模型实现高效的对比评估方案。为什么需要云端GPU进行模型对比测试万物识别模型通常基于深度学习框架构建对计算资源有较高要求显存需求大即使是基础版的中文识别模型也需要4GB以上显存才能流畅运行依赖复杂不同模型可能依赖特定版本的PyTorch、CUDA等组件环境隔离多个模型同时测试时容易产生依赖冲突实测发现在本地8GB显存的消费级显卡上同时运行两个中等规模的识别模型就会出现显存不足的问题。而云端GPU环境可以轻松提供16GB甚至24GB显存让模型对比测试更加顺畅。预置镜像快速部署方案目前CSDN算力平台提供了包含主流中文识别模型的预置镜像我们可以直接使用登录算力平台控制台在镜像市场搜索万物识别或Chinese Recognition选择包含以下组件的镜像PyTorch 1.12CUDA 11.3预装模型权重Chinese-CLIPWenLanR2D2其他中文识别模型部署完成后系统会自动分配GPU资源并启动容器。整个过程通常不超过5分钟相比本地部署节省了大量时间。模型测试与对比方法进入容器环境后我们可以通过简单的Python脚本快速测试不同模型# 示例测试Chinese-CLIP模型 from models.chinese_clip import ChineseCLIP model ChineseCLIP(devicecuda:0) result model.predict(这是一只橘猫) print(result)建议采用以下对比维度准确率测试准备100-200张涵盖不同场景的测试图片记录各模型在相同测试集上的Top-1和Top-5准确率推理速度使用相同尺寸的输入图像测量单张图片的平均处理时间显存占用通过nvidia-smi命令监控显存使用情况记录峰值显存占用高效对比测试技巧经过多次实践我总结了几个提升测试效率的技巧批量测试脚本编写自动化脚本依次加载不同模型避免手动切换#!/bin/bash for model in clip wenlan r2d2; do python test_$model.py --input test_images/ done结果可视化使用Matplotlib生成对比图表直观展示各模型表现import matplotlib.pyplot as plt models [CLIP, WenLan, R2D2] accuracy [0.85, 0.82, 0.78] plt.bar(models, accuracy) plt.title(模型准确率对比) plt.savefig(result.png)显存优化对于大模型可以采用以下方法降低显存需求使用FP16精度启用梯度检查点分批处理输入数据常见问题与解决方案在实际测试过程中可能会遇到以下典型问题问题1显存不足错误提示如果遇到CUDA out of memory错误可以尝试减小batch size或使用更小的模型变体问题2模型加载失败检查模型权重路径是否正确确认CUDA版本与模型要求匹配尝试重新下载模型权重问题3推理速度慢确保输入图像尺寸符合模型预期检查是否启用了GPU加速考虑使用ONNX或TensorRT优化模型总结与下一步建议通过云端GPU环境我们可以高效完成多个中文识别模型的对比测试。这种方法特别适合需要快速评估模型性能的产品和技术团队。根据我的经验整个测试流程可以从传统的一周时间缩短到几小时内完成。后续可以尝试测试更多新兴的中文识别模型探索模型融合方案结合各模型优势针对特定业务场景进行微调现在就可以部署一个预置镜像开始你的模型对比测试之旅。记住选择适合业务需求的模型比单纯追求准确率更重要希望这套方案能帮助你做出更明智的技术选型决策。